Left in the Darkness
She wants to scream and let it all go.
Left in the darkness
To cry all alone
She wants to scream
And let it all go
But instead all night
She will fight for control
Gets up in the morning worn and tired to the bone
Wondering if this will ever end
Plasters on her face a smile
Thinks to herself
It's only for a while
Goes through the day like any other
Without complaint waiting for the pain to get better
Goes through the halls of her school in a daze
Gets home and finally lets her anger go, like a blaze
She fights with her mother
And punches her brother
Gets kicked out of her home
Has nowhere to go
Searches the streets all night
For a place to sleep
Finally finds the light
In an old motherly woman
Who will take her in with all of her faults
Now she no longer has to fight for control
She no longer wants to scream and let it all go
She is no longer left in the darkness
To cry all alone.
